Favourites:
 
Roberto Cavalli
 
I adore Mr Cavalli's designs and the sleek but sexy perfume bottle is no exception, and although I've not been fortunate enough to own one of his amazing dresses, at least I feel a tiny bit celebrity-like wearing this.
 
A pungent smell of fruity sweetness with just the slightest hint of musk, a vivid picture of eating fruit salad on a Summer's morning with a slight breeze wafting the scent of fresh bloomed flowers comes to mind.
 
Dior Hypnotic Poison
 
There is a really good reason why this is the favourite amongst many women, myself included,, they could not have chosen a better word for this fragrance because the smell is indeed hypnotic.
 
An immediate hit of vanilla and musk with just a few spritzes will keep you smelling as beautiful as you are the whole day.  It's such a delicate yet strong fragrance, the smells balanced just perfectly, and will make you reach for a whiff constantly.
 
  Dolce & Gabbana The One
 
One of my favourite bottles, I like a perfume that is sleek and stylish, when it comes to perfume packaging the less fuss the better. 
 
A fresh bouquet of floral sweetness hits your nose at first, but settles into a wonderfully vanilla and amber fragrance.  It smells sexy and now I know why they've chosen Brazilian bombshell Gisele Bunchen as their spokeswomen for this perfume.
 
Gucci by Gucci
 
Another sleek bottle of this iconic brand.  This perfume has a slight similarity to the Roberto Cavalli fragrance, and it might be the pungent fruity sweetness that hits you first.  But this settles into a very delicate and wearable fragrance.
 
Harajuku Lovers G
 
How totally cute is the packaging?  Designed by Gwen Stefani this pretty little thing was discovered in the sales section of a local drug store, and I was absolutely delighted to have found such a gem.
 
This fragrance is packed with an overwhelming smell of coconuts, and reminds me of lazy days on the beach with a cocktail in hand, feeling the sun on my body and finding slight relief from the breeze on my skin.  It's basically holiday in a bottle.
 
Pink Sugar
 
Candy and sweets in a bottle, there is no better way for me to describe this scent as being in a candy shop, with smells of candyfloss, cupcakes and other delicious sweet treats wafting your way.  It's a very strong fragrance initially, but once settled into your sweet, leaves you with just the slightest scent of deliciousness.
 
Escada Magnetism
 
This has been a firm favourite for years, and although only available at selected stores I will do whatever I can to keep this in my collection. 
 
A beautiful black current, vanilla and musk blend, not too sweet but beautifully balanced with just the right amount of aromas to keep you wanting more.  A little goes a long way, and it indeed settles into a magnetic fragrance on your skin.
